Subject: [PATCH RFC] vm: Adjust ifdef for TINY_RCU

There is an ifdef in page_cache_get_speculative() that checks for !SMP
and TREE_RCU, which has been an impossible combination since the advent
of TINY_RCU.  The ifdef enables a fastpath that is valid when preemption
is disabled by rcu_read_lock() in UP systems, which is the case when
TINY_RCU is enabled.  This commit therefore adjusts the ifdef to generate
the fastpath when TINY_RCU is enabled.

diff --git a/include/linux/pagemap.h b/include/linux/pagemap.h
index 0e38e13..e3dea75 100644
--- a/include/linux/pagemap.h
+++ b/include/linux/pagemap.h
@@ -149,7 +149,7 @@ static inline int page_cache_get_speculative(struct page *page)
 {
 	VM_BUG_ON(in_interrupt());
 
-#if !defined(CONFIG_SMP) && defined(CONFIG_TREE_RCU)
+#ifdef CONFIG_TINY_RCU
 # ifdef CONFIG_PREEMPT_COUNT
 	VM_BUG_ON(!in_atomic());
 # endif
